Appearance - 10 | Aroma - 6 | Flavor - 7 | Texture - 10 | Overall - 7.5
Bottle: Very dark, red-brown with a creamy tan head.....one of those pours that does that cool, roiling, dark to light flip. Caramel, light cream aroma. The taste is soft, sweet caramel malt, vanilla, milk....chocolate malt. Very nice....easy drinking, nicely bodied and really creamy.
